Being safe in your everyday life needs knowledge. If you remember the following information, your life will be much safer. ● Always notice the environment around you. You shouldn"t walk alone outside. Make sure where the public phones are. If anything dangerous happens, you can find them easily. ● Your bag should be carried towards the front of your body instead of putting it on your back. When a bus is full of people, it is easy enough for a thief to take away the things in the bag on your back. ● If you are followed by someone you don"t know, cross the street and go to the other way, let the person understand that you know he or she is after you. Next, don"t go home at once. You are safer in the street than you are alone in your home or in a lift (电梯). ● If you have to take a bus to a place far away, try to get to the stop a few minutes earlier before the bus leaves. This stops other people from studying you. On the bus, don"t sit alone. Sit behind the driver or with other people. Don"t sleep. |

Eating habits (习惯) are different in different countries. The Chinese have a saying "Eat good things for breakfast, eat a big meal for lunch, but eat less at dinner." Many Americans agree that one should start the day with a good breakfast, but their ideas about lunch and dinner are different. Most Americans only give themselves a short time for lunch. So they eat a small lunch. After work they will have more time to eat a big dinner. Also a quiet dinner at home with all the family talking about their day is a way to take a good rest after a long, hard day of work. Eating at restaurants is also different. In China, people like to talk and laugh while eating.Very often you can hear people talking and laughing loudly, and they are just having a good time. In America it is not like this. They want a quiet place where they can eat a good meal far away from the noises of the outside world. If someone is talking too loudly, the manager of the restaurant will look at him or her angrily. If some people are talking too loudly, the manager (经理) of the restaurant may come out and ask them to be quiet. |
